About the role
Job description American Plastics, headquartered in St. Louis, Missouri, is a leading designer and manufacturer of innovative plastic-injection molded products for the household & garage storage and commercial cleaning end-markets. We are seeking a skilled Sr. Design Engineer specializing in plastics to join our team at our Innovation Center, in Jefferson City, MO. This position will lead a team of design engineers and will be responsible for designing and developing plastic components and products, ensuring functionality, manufacturability, and cost-effectiveness. The role involves collaborating with cross-functional teams, utilizing CAD software, and staying updated on industry trends and technologies. This position will report to the Vice President of Engineering. - Product Design: Conceptualize, design, and develop plastic components and products according to project requirements, considering factors such as functionality, aesthetics, manufacturability, and cost-effectiveness. - CAD Modeling: Utilize CAD software (e.g., SolidWorks, CATIA) to create detailed 3D models and 2D drawings of plastic parts and assemblies. - Prototyping: Oversee the prototyping process, including selecting appropriate materials, collaborating with prototype technicians, and validating designs for fit, form, and function. - Material Selection: Evaluate and select suitable plastic materials based on performance requirements, environmental factors, and cost considerations. - Design Optimization: Continuously improve designs for efficiency, performance, and cost reduction through analysis, simulation, and testing. - Manufacturability: Collaborate with manufacturing teams to ensure designs are optimized for production processes such as injection molding, extrusion, and thermoforming. - Quality Assurance: Work closely with quality control teams to establish and implement quality standards for plastic components and products, ensuring compliance with industry regulations. - Documentation: Prepare and maintain comprehensive design documentation, including technical drawings, specifications, and design change records. - Cross-functional Collaboration: Collaborate effectively with cross-functional teams including product management, manufacturing, quality assurance, and procurement to achieve project goals and deadlines. - Research and Innovation: Stay updated on industry trends, emerging technologies, and best practices in plastic design, and incorporate innovative solutions into product development processes. Requirements - Bachelor's degree in mechanical or plastics Engineering - Excellent at leading and developing a team - Experience of hands-on injection molding experience a plus. - 7 + Years experience with Product Design of plastic injection molded products - SolidWorks knowledge. - Experience with prototyping techniques and rapid iteration processes. - Excellent problem-solving skills and attention to detail. - Effective communication and collaboration skills with the ability to work in cross-functional teams. - Familiarity with design for manufacturability (DFM) and design for assembly (DFA) principles. - Ability to prioritize tasks and manage multiple projects simultaneously. - Strong communication skills.
